Please find below an excerpt from a King World News interview with Egon Von Greyerz of Matterhorn Asset Management, Zurich, which puts into perspective the recent announcement that Swiss banks now offered allocated accounts for precious metals:


“A couple of days ago Swiss banks came out with a major PR campaign offering allocated gold and silver accounts. Well,  that’s nothing new, they have always done that. The banks are worried that more and more investors are taking gold outside of the banking system.
So now the banks are telling investors these allocated accounts are safe and would not be included in any bankruptcy. But the bottom line is this gold and silver will be encumbered, and maybe even owned by central banks who will claim it back one day.
We must remember history. Look at Lehman, MF Global, Sentinel. These companies, which all collapsed, had allocated and segregated assets. These assets were used as security for their credit lines. Therefore investors did not get their money back.
The two major banks leading this campaign in Switzerland, UBS and Credit Suisse, represent 600% of Swiss GDP. This exposes the entire Swiss banking industry. So investors should not participate in that program.”
The only truly safe way to own gold is physical bullion, completely outside the banking system, in a secure location, not subject to liens, encumbrances, re-hypothecation and misleading advertising, by the same banks that brought us Libor fraud etc.

THE "GOLD IS IN THE POST"

THE "GOLD IS IN THE POST"


  1. A ton of gold is a cube, which measures 37.5 x 37.5 x 37.5 cm, smaller than a standard kitchen microwave.
    Thus the entire 3,000 or so ton stack of Gold owned by Germany, would fit comfortably into the living / dining room of a normal family house.
    We are to believe that this gold, held in the most secure vaults in the world, has never been audited since the 1950′s?
    Now we learn that only 300 tons will be delivered to Germany over 7 years. A Boeing 747 Cargo plane has a payload of 100 tons, so why not deliver over 3 days?
    The proposed delivery represents less that 1 ton per week, and this whole story is the strongest indicator yet that the physical gold supposedly in the Fed vaults does not exist.

THE TRILLION DOLLAR COIN

THE TRILLION DOLLAR COIN

In a financial world composed essentially of complete absurdity, a new idea has been floated to create a new USD 1 Trillion Platinum coin.

The US treasury cannot print its own money but can in exceptional cases mint a coin. The idea is that Mr Geithner gets the US Mint to mint the coin, worth USD 1 Trillion, and then goes the the Federal Reserve to deposit it in the Treasury bank account, thus reducing the overdraft and avoiding the debt ceiling. So far so good ???

There is a small technical problem, that Platinum is an extremely rare element, with an annual production in 2010 of 200,000 Kg. With a current market price of USD 50,000 per Kilo annual production equates  to approximately USD 10 Billion.

Hence a USD 1 Trillion coin would represent 100 years of future Platinum production.

This idea has been lauded by Nobel prize winning Keynesian economist Paul Krugman.
